Take the word
“succubus”
for example.
It designates in the Christian religion the
"female demon who comes at night to unite with a man"
, explains the Robert.
It is a synonym for
"devilness"
.
"Ingambe"
is the opposite of
"fringant"
, and means, jokingly and in old language: "who has normal use of his legs".
As for the
"ponant"
, it designates the setting sun.
Its antonym is the
"rising"
.
